Joe Biden’s Cancer Diagnosis, announced on May 18, 2025, confirmed former President Joe Biden has aggressive prostate cancer that has spread to his bones.

“Last week, President Joe Biden was seen for a prostate nodule after urinary symptoms,” his office told CNN. Specifically, the cancer, with a Gleason score of 9, is hormone-sensitive, allowing effective management.

Nonetheless, the spread of the disease indicates a serious condition. President Biden, aged 82, is considering various treatment paths, according to Reuters. This health situation involving Biden brings up concerns regarding transparency in public health matters.

The Biden Cancer Diagnosis followed a routine exam on May 12, 2025, when doctors found a prostate nodule, per The New York Times.

For example, Biden’s office noted the cancer’s high-grade nature but emphasized treatment possibilities.

Moreover, hormone therapy and chemotherapy offer hope, per Dr. Benjamin Davies in CNN.

Treatment Options Explored

Biden’s team is evaluating treatments for the Biden Cancer Diagnosis. Notably, hormone-sensitive cancers respond to therapies that extend life.

In addition, chemotherapy and radiation are options, though bone metastasis complicates prognosis.

“It’s very serious,” Davies told CNN, noting newer therapies like immunotherapy show promise.
